Output d0bacf5b88f6ef68aa7212daa5d56f44f00a336206011bf47b35ddfb0938d8b2:0

value
60991644
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 650b3b7c2aa349af7bed9a36563afdac8130dbf83ecd0146aaeabbcb5889248f
address
bc1pv59nklp25dy677ldngm9vwha4jqnpklc8mxsz342a2aukkyfyj8srxj2gp
transaction
d0bacf5b88f6ef68aa7212daa5d56f44f00a336206011bf47b35ddfb0938d8b2
confirmations
21142
spent
true